You can’t have too much RAM, on servers at least. That’s why Samsung has released what seems to be the smallest high-density memory module and at the same time, the first in the world, carrying 16GB DDR3. Of course, these are targeted towards servers, but there is also a 8GB DDR3 RDIMM version available. Now, they haven’t forgotten about us, because a 4GB DDR3 stick will be available for consumers. According to Samsung, the 16GB DDR3 stick will be cost and performance effective. No prices are known for any of the new DDR3 modules, but it is said that they will be available soon.
